Ingredients for a Perfect Low-Fat Strawberry Smoothie
Creating a low-fat strawberry smoothie requires minimal ingredients, all of which contribute to its deliciousness and healthiness. Below are the essentials:
- Frozen Strawberries: 2 cups (250 g) – These provide a thick, icy texture that makes the smoothie refreshing.
- Low-Fat Milk: 1 cup (240 mL) – Choose dairy or plant-based alternatives like almond milk for fewer calories.
- Honey or Sweetener: 2 tablespoons (30 g) – For natural sweetness, honey is ideal, but alternatives like maple syrup or stevia work well too.
- Vanilla Extract: ¼ teaspoon (optional) – This ingredient enhances the flavor, giving a hint of strawberry pie sweetness.
How to Prepare Your Strawberry Smoothie
Making a low-fat strawberry smoothie is quick and straightforward. Follow these simple steps to whip up your drink:
Step 1: Gather Your Ingredients
Before you start blending, make sure you have all your ingredients ready. If using fresh strawberries, consider adding ice for a frosty consistency.
Step 2: Blend Your Ingredients
Begin the blending process by pouring in the low-fat milk first. This helps create a smoother texture:
- Add the frozen strawberries, followed by honey and vanilla extract.
- Blend on high until you achieve a creamy and smooth consistency.
Step 3: Taste and Adjust
After blending, give your smoothie a taste test. If you desire more sweetness, incorporate additional honey or sweetener and blend briefly.
Step 4: Serve Immediately
Pour your homemade smoothie into glasses and enjoy the fresh flavors while it’s at its best!

Fun Variations to Try
One of the most enjoyable aspects of smoothies is their customizability. Don’t hesitate to experiment with these variations:
- Add Greek Yogurt: For a creamier texture and extra protein, consider incorporating ½ cup of low-fat Greek yogurt.
- Include Other Fruits: Mix in fruits like bananas or blueberries for diverse flavors and nutrients.
- Boost with Greens: Sneak in a handful of spinach or kale for added nutrition without altering taste.
- Incorporate Seeds: Add chia or flaxseeds for extra fiber and omega-3 fatty acids.
